Maja Z. Katusic, M.D., is a Developmental-Behavioral Pediatrician, with a special clinical interest in autism spectrum disorder and developmental delay.

Her clinical focus includes:

  • Expertise in comprehensive medical evaluation and management of children from infancy through 18 years of age who present for a wide range of developmental or behavioral concerns, including autism spectrum disorder, developmental delay, intellectual disability, learning difficulties, ADHD, and disruptive behavior.
  • Evaluating children through Mayo Clinic Developmental Behavioral Pediatrics to determine how to best serve the needs of her patients and their families.
  • Utilizing a compassionate, patient and family centered approach when formulating the plan of care for your child and your family.

In addition to her clinical activities, Dr. Katusic is actively involved in research, with a special focus on investigating risk factors and outcomes in autism spectrum disorder. She is also passionate about education of medical students, residents, and her patient families about the field of Developmental Behavioral Pediatrics.
